G The elemental unit of an air heater consists of a long circular rod of diameter D, which is encapsulated by a finned sleeve and in which thermal energy is generated by ohmic heating. The N fins of thickness t and length L are integrally fabricated with the square sleeve of width w. Under steady-state operating conditions, the rate of thermal energy generation corresponds to the rate of heat transfer to airflow over the sleeve. (a) Under conditions for which a uniform surface temperature Ts is maintained around the circumference of the heater and the temperature T and convection coefficient h of the airflow are known, obtain an expression for the rate of heat transfer per unit length to the air. Evaluate the heat rate for Ts 300C, D 20 mm, an aluminum sleeve (ks 240 W/m K), w 40 mm, N 16, t 4 mm, L 20 mm, T 50C, and h 500 W/m2 K.
